The Adult Education and Faith Formation program of any parish should have certain goals in mind.

First, it should assist the parishioners in strengthening their spirituality and their relationship with Jesus Christ.

Secondly, it should afford the people of the parish a resource in the form of the Director to whom they can go with ideas and suggestions for adult faith based programs.

Lastly, programs should encompass those of not only a spiritual nature but of personal enrichment as well. The Director should be kept informed about all Adult faith programs operating in the parish and should work closely with the Pastor to meet the needs of the parishioners.

Looking to Become Catholic or Complete Your Sacraments?
If you or a family member or friend would like to become Catholic or complete the sacraments of initiation there is a warm, welcoming place here at Saint Bartholomew Parish waiting for you.

Through a process called the RCIA/C (Rite of Christian Initiation of Adults and Children) one can enter into the Catholic faith or receive the sacraments of First Holy Communion and or Confirmation and therefore complete their initiation into the faith. New classes will be forming this Spring.
